The trouble, at least with PBSB, is they are stating the rooms will be habitable. Trouble for us, according to Alaska Airlines, is the airport will not be open on Nov 2nd. So PBSB may take the position our room was ready to occupy so it's not their problem.

Update: The reservations staff at PBSB has been great working with us on making new reservations. They even got approve from management to let us use our 2014 weeks in 2015 if needed. Airport is supposed to open today so we may get there this year after all.
